golang 变量注解

admin 2024-11-21 16:05:05 编程 来源:ZONE.CI 全球网 0 阅读模式

Go语言(Golang)是一种由Google开发的开源编程语言,它以其并发性、简洁性和高效性而受到了广泛的关注。在Golang中,变量注解是一种非常重要的特性,它可以帮助我们更好地理解和使用变量。在本文中,我将介绍Golang变量注解的基本概念以及其在实际开发中的应用。

变量注解的基本概念

变量注解是通过在变量声明时添加额外的信息来描述变量的类型、作用等属性的一种方式。在Golang中,变量注解是通过在变量名后面使用冒号分隔符(:)来实现的。例如,var name string:这里的字符串“string”就是对变量name进行注解,表示它的类型是字符串。

变量注解的作用

变量注解在Golang中具有多种作用,包括以下几个方面:

1. 类型约束:通过变量注解,我们可以明确指定变量的类型,这样就可以在编译时进行类型检查,避免使用错误的类型导致程序运行出错。

2. 代码可读性:变量注解可以帮助开发者理解变量的含义和用途,提高代码的可读性和可维护性。当我们在阅读代码时,可以根据变量注解快速了解变量的属性,避免产生困惑。

3. IDE支持:许多集成开发环境(IDE)都提供了对变量注解的支持,例如自动补全、语法提示等功能。通过使用变量注解,我们可以更好地利用这些功能,提高开发效率。

变量注解的实际应用

在实际的Golang开发中,变量注解有许多常见的应用场景:

1. 函数参数和返回值注解:通过在函数声明中对参数和返回值进行注解,可以明确指定它们的类型和含义,提高函数的可读性和可理解性。

2. 结构体字段注解:在定义结构体时,可以对字段进行注解,以描述字段的类型、作用等属性。这样做可以使结构体更加清晰易懂,便于复用。

3. 接口方法注解:在定义接口时,可以对其方法进行注解,以说明方法的功能和约定。这样其他开发者实现接口时就能更好地理解接口的用途。

总之,Golang中的变量注解是一种非常有用的特性,它可以帮助我们更好地理解和使用变量。通过合理地使用变量注解,我们可以提高代码的可读性和可维护性,减少潜在的错误,并且能够更好地利用开发工具。因此,在实际开发中,我们应该充分利用变量注解的优势,合理注释变量,使代码更加规范和易于理解。

weinxin
版权声明
本站原创文章转载请注明文章出处及链接,谢谢合作!
golang 变量注解 编程

golang 变量注解

Go语言(Golang)是一种由Google开发的开源编程语言,它以其并发性、简洁性和高效性而受到了广泛的关注。在Golang中,变量注解是一种非常重要的特性,
idea搭建golang环境 编程

idea搭建golang环境

搭建Golang开发环境 在如今快速发展的软件开发行业中,Go语言(简称Golang)以其高效的性能、简洁的语法和开发速度成为了许多开发者的首选。若你也希望成为
golang 创建目录 makeall 编程

golang 创建目录 makeall

创建目录是开发中常用的功能,可以帮助我们在项目中组织和管理文件。在golang中,创建目录是一项非常简单的任务。本文将介绍如何使用golang创建目录,并提供一
golang清楚管道数据 编程

golang清楚管道数据

什么是Golang管道(Channel)Golang是一种非常流行的编程语言,它被设计成简洁、高效、并发安全。在Golang中,管道(Channel)是一种特殊
评论:0   参与:  0